Experience the “Heart of the City” Easter Sunday Farmers Market in UN Plaza on Sunday, April 16, 2017 in San Francisco, California. It is a uniquely independent, farmer-operated, nonprofit farmers market.

Around 30 local farmers and artisan food vendors provide a wide array of fresh local produce, pastas, bakery, hummus, kettle corn and farm products. This market is open year round, rain or shine, from 7:00 am to 5:00 pm on Sundays, and from 7:00 am to 5:30 pm un Wednesdays.

Part of Heart of the City Farmers Market mission is to bring healthy food and nutrition education outreach to a fresh food desert that lacks a grocery store. Since the market’s first day 1981, their farmers have been committed to helping to create a healthy Heart of the City.

The market is located along Market Street between 7th and 8th Streets above Civic Center BART Station. The Market Information Tent is near the intersection of Hyde and Fulton.
